Teaching Experience
‘Creativity is inventing, experimenting, growing, taking risks, breaking rules, making mistakes and having fun.’
As a teacher I aim to influence students, not only their educational development, but help to instil confidence to help grow as a person. I aim to create a space where they can take risks, express their creativity, be honest and open.
My lessons are based on my own experience as a working musician.
After finishing my studies at BIMM (Brighton Institute of Modern Music) I set up my own private music teaching school.
I had a large student base. Students ranged from 5 to 65 years old. As well as teaching one to one and group lessons, I also ran choirs, hosted summer schools, and workshops.
I then took some time out to travel the world. My first stop was India where I had the privilege of doing a music workshop at Educators trust in Anjuna, Goa. A charity run school for children with families living in slums.
I finally landed in New Zealand, where I worked as a musician and taught for New Zealand School of Rock for a short time.
I have experience working within school settings and working with large groups of children and children with SEN.
